## Runbook: Flaky Integration Tests — Ledgerpost Payments

When the Ledgerpost integration suite flakes, it is almost always the mock acquirer timing out under parallel runs. Retry once before investigating. If failures persist, compare the suite's runtime settings against the approved baseline, since contractors sometimes inherit stale local overrides. The baseline configuration for the test harness appears below.

service settings:
PRAWYN_PIN=9848
PRAWYN_METRICS_HOST=metrics.prawyn.lumicworks.corp
PRAWYN_LOG_LEVEL=warn
PRAWYN_TENANT=pelius

Q2 blended margin: 41.3%, down 2.1 pts. Drivers: freight on the Ostrand line, discount creep in the Kelvane region, and warranty accruals on Tarn units. Actions: freight surcharges from next month; discount caps enforced; Tarn supplier renegotiation underway. Target: 43% by year-end. Finance to report weekly variance to regional leads. No external sharing; figures are pre-audit. Escalate anomalies above 0.5 pts directly to the controller. Strategic context for the margin targets is set out in the note below.

board note of baweg-bawig: Project Tamath slips by six weeks because of the audit delay.

### Step 4 — Configure the formula sandbox

Tallysheet evaluates user-supplied spreadsheet formulas inside the Quarrel sandbox, a separate process with no filesystem or network access. Set `SANDBOX_MAX_CELLS` to 50000 and `SANDBOX_TIMEOUT_MS` to 2000 in the env file before first deploy; defaults are too permissive for the Brinport cluster. The sandbox supervisor verifies each worker binary against a signed manifest at spawn time, and the signing key it checks against is set on the line directly below.

vault entry, yahif-yajep: COURIER_KEY29=b802bdf8034096b65a51c6ba5abe2